TASTI: Semantic Indexes for Machine Learning-based Queries over Unstructured Data

Summary: Proposes TASTI, a trainable semantic index replacing per-query proxies with embeddings so similar records share outputs. Theoretically ties embedding error to accuracy; empirically on five multimodal datasets, it builds 10x cheaper indexes and 24x faster proxy queries. (summarized by gpt-5-nano on Feb 09 2026)
